Anyone ever targeted them this time of year during the spawn? From what I've been reading, they tend to go shallow towards feeder creeks. I know a few North Jersey Walleye spots with nice feeder creeks, so I will probably be giving that a shot. My question is, what type of lure should I be using? Jigs during the day and stickbaits at night "rule" still hold true for the spawn? Input?
bunker dunker
03-21-2012, 12:14 PM
last hour of like first hour of dark.slow reel sticks like the husky jerks or smithwicks.in a few weeks they will be crushing top water stuff
